Transaction aa31e43c8023662e11c506c046150ee53bdfca854bf122ed58b835fa594ca26a
1 Input
1 Output
-
aa31e43c8023662e11c506c046150ee53bdfca854bf122ed58b835fa594ca26a:0
- value
- 876008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bde9d99c4d76927470e2ad19242bd465ebef987 OP_EQUAL
- address
- 38cBHY3Nc24HAebj4iZJRae3tP8xWxdpXX